Oversees and has full responsibility over all operational support aspects of the contact center. Must facilitate and monitor all workforce planning issues, including staffing, scheduling and forecasting systems, and policy and procedure.
May monitor the implementation and execution of all training programs across the contact center. Oversees all aspects of contact center quality issues and support systems implementation and management.
May be responsible for multiple contact centers.Positions on this level are fully proficient in executing established standards. Works independently within set frames and follows set course.
Has a knowledge base typically acquired from a professional/university degree and approximately 1-2 years of practical professional experience in a particular area.
Develops own knowledge, shares best practice and develops relevant/appropriate solutions. Positions at this level are expected to continuously improve the day-to-day activities/processes.
